I love plastic scraper blades for lifting purge lines and small prints off the print bed, but find the handles they typically come with don't hold the blade very well. These handles allow the blade to slide into side and prevent it from popping off. Each has a gentle curve to make picking them up easier. The long version makes it easier to reach the back of the plate, especially useful to getting to purge blocks or stray poo blobs. The standard and long versions are roughly 122mm and 188mm respectively. Printing Both handles print on their edge to avoid support in the blade slot and increase strength. Assembly No post processing is needed. Just slide in a blade and get to scraping those purge lines ;) Notes The plastic blades are very inexpensive and can be found on sites like Amazon: https://www.amazon.com/plastic-razor/s?k=plastic+razor Metal blades fit as well, just a bit looser.
